We were trying to find a place to enjoy some drinks and food, me being vegan. There was two of us but total three and when we came in to the restaurant, the older waiter told us that he would not have a table for us tonight at all but there were three bar seats open so we grabbed them. Prior to coming when I called, I was told that there was no vegan menu but cheese could be omitted and vegan pizza can be made for me. The menus were given to us by the younger waiter that was new, we asked for beer second and he told us that he was training and needed to double check which was totally fine. The order was taken by the older waiter and food was brought to us very quickly but after that, we were never checked on after, the third person came in to join us and we had to ask for a menu, we ordered from the cook becasue the both waiters were so busy w tables that they could not bother taking our order or checking up on guests seating at the bar, we were basically just left unattended. We asked for the check and wanted to split it and the older waiter said it could only be split in half which I have never heard of. I wanted until he was done w someone and told him that the customer service or lack of it gave me no desire to come back there again and he just shrugged his shoulders and said that the other waiter was new. Maybe you should not have a new waiter on a busy restaurant on a Friday night.

Two solid starts for food and the ambiance - the pizza was delicious, super thin crust, the tomato sauce had a kick and it was a perfectly balanced between all the veggies. The bar also was super rad, it had a old gentlemen's vibe w books, old record and dark wood.

Angie’s is like stepping into a glam-vintage 1960’s parlor. It’s both sexy and playful at the same time, incredibly intimate yet also full of energy. It’s equally a great spot for a cozy date or a stand-out dinner for visitors.

This place is all about the pizza, with the dazzling black pizza oven as the establishment’s centerpiece. We had the hot sausage pizza, which was surprisingly puckish — the smoked cheddar gave the classic Italian pizza a solidly American twist.

We also enjoyed the mixed green salad, with a light vinegar dressing to cut through the heavy, flavorful pizza. We also gave in and got the meatballs as well — don’t skip them, if you’ve still got room in your tummy for them!

The surprise stand out of the night was the Ghia Spritz — a $6 canned mocktail, it had a delightfully complex flavor and hit all the same notes as a cocktail worth twice its price. If you’re skipping the booze for the evening, the Ghia is a must!!! We liked it so much that we went and bought a pack from the grocery store — however, there was just something about having it at Angie’s that made it even more tasty.

Angie’s is like stepping into a glam-vintage 1960’s parlor. It’s both sexy and playful at the same time, incredibly intimate yet also full of energy. It’s equally a great spot for a cozy date or a stand-out dinner for visitors. This place is all about the pizza, with the dazzling black pizza oven as the establishment’s centerpiece. We had the hot sausage pizza, which was surprisingly puckish — the smoked cheddar gave the classic Italian pizza a solidly American twist. We also enjoyed the mixed green salad, with a light vinegar dressing to cut through the heavy, flavorful pizza. We also gave in and got the meatballs as well — don’t skip them, if you’ve still got room in your tummy for them! The surprise stand out of the night was the Ghia Spritz — a $6 canned mocktail, it had a delightfully complex flavor and hit all the same notes as a cocktail worth twice its price. If you’re skipping the booze for the evening, the Ghia is a must!!! We liked it so much that we went and bought a pack from the grocery store — however, there was just something about having it at Angie’s that made it even more tasty. The retro vibes alone are reason enough to check it out, but the food and service makes it a slam dunk. If you haven’t tried Angie’s yet, you really need to!!!

Very impressed by the food here at Angie’s! We dropped in on a Monday (yes, brilliantly open on a Monday), and we’re seated in a back booth. The place is beautifully decorated and transports you back in time and to a very specific vibe. Only unfortunate thing about the space is that it can get very loud - we were seated near two parties and their laughs often echoed toward us. We ordered: - Marinated cucumbers: so simple and delicious. The sweet and spicy peanuts were a smart and delightful touch! - Meatballs: the order only comes with 2, which is a shame because they’re so tasty. Juicy, tender, meaty and nestled in a pool of flavorful tomato sauce… we saved the sauce to dip our crust into! - Eggplant pizza: probably won’t get this one again as it didn’t taste as special as others on the menu looked; however, we were really impressed by the cook on the crust. It’s incredibly thin yet still holds up to toppings without being dry! - Peach mascarpone ice cream: absolutely divine, perfect end to a lovely meal We will definitely be back and look out for Angie’s for takeout too!
